Basic data Standard ID | GA 95-2015 (GA95-2015) | Description (Translated English) | Service for fire extinguishers | Sector / Industry | Public Security (Police) Industry Standard | Classification of Chinese Standard | C84 | Classification of International Standard | 13.220.20 | Word Count Estimation | 13,140 | Date of Issue | 2015-10-12 | Date of Implementation | 2016-02-01 | Older Standard (superseded by this standard) | GA 95-2007; GA 402-2002 | Quoted Standard | GB 4351.1; GB 5099; GB 5100; GB 8109; GB/T 9251; GB 50444; GA 1157 | Issuing agency(ies) | Ministry of Public Security | Summary | This standard specifies the fire extinguisher repair terminology and definitions, general requirements, maintenance conditions, maintenance technical requirements, retirement and disposal, test methods and inspection rules. This standard applies to portable fire extinguishers and cart-type fire extinguisher maintenance. |

Fire extinguisher maintenance
1 Scope
This standard specifies the terms and definitions fire extinguisher maintenance, general requirements, maintenance conditions, technical requirements for maintenance, disposal and recycling scrap test
Methods and inspection rules.
This standard applies to portable fire extinguishers and wheeled fire extinguishers maintenance.
